Hi everyone, I've had a couple of days glancing through some of the posts on here, so trying not to ask to many questions that have already been asked before :bang:

Anyway as the title says I am looking at buying a Bravo in the next few months, mainly to lower my running costs. I'm looking at either the 1.9multijet Sport, or the 2.0 165 Sport. Is 1 any better than the other, or are they pretty much like for like?

I know some Bravo's came with a 5year warranty, Was this just a short term deal, and if so, does anyone know what plate these will be on?

I think that sums up the annoying noob questions for now :)

Oh and before anyone says swapping to a diesel for cheaper motoring is a bit of a false economy, well yes I agree in some cases it is. But I'll be swaping my Impreza Turbo for a Diesel, so the MPG will at least be twice as good! In fact could I get a Bravo down to 6mpg? lol
 
i have the 1.9 150bhp version.. great motor.

2.0 is a little smoother and shaves about 1 secs of the 0-60 time, emissions are less on the 165 but have a DPF system that i wouldnt trust.
Both engines are great but the 1.9 is a older unit used in many other cars today - so its proven.

You wouldnt and hope a new bravo petrol or diesel will do 6mpg. Around town with a heavy foot - always on boost expect 22-25mpg.
On a long civilised run 55-60mpg. mixed i get around 35mpg.

The 5 year warranty was on for a while, not exactly sure when, mines a july 2008 and it has 3 years.

Hope this helped you a little

Hi mate

I've owned my Bravo for little over 2 weeks now and I love it

I have the 1.9 active sport 120...from what i can make it out, they don't make that engine any more since end of 2008 as it was replaced by something else, but its really good..im getting about 40mpg mixed at the moment (runs to barnsley to leeds, barnsley to rotherham)

5 year warranty from what i can make out was a promotion..fiat standard warranty is 3 years i think.

Replaced with the 1.6 120 which I have.

Fiats warrenty is 2 year manufacturer and 1 year dealer.
 
Mines only the petrol1.4 (90) but Im very pleased so far after 7k. use. Im used to the comparatively low performance because I had a 1.2 stilo (!)before and its not a problem for me. I got 51mpg last week on motorway journeys. Typically 45-48 average motoring.
 
5 year warranty would be on the 57 and 08 perhaps. I think that's around the time they offered it.

Mines an 07 (yeah she's getting on a bit!) and still having tonnes of fun. I'm sure you'll miss the noise of the Scoob but for getting around they're a very good car, quick for it's class, and probably still best looking.
